Identifying Peak Periods

Seasonal trends in N2O usage are often influenced by industry-specific demands. For instance, the medical sector sees increased usage during flu seasons and peak surgical periods when anesthesia requirements go up. Similarly, the food industry might experience a surge in demand during holiday seasons when production of whipped cream and other culinary products increases.

By analyzing historical data, businesses can predict when these peaks are likely to occur. Leveraging analytics tools can provide insights into trends, helping companies to plan their inventory and logistics accordingly.

Strategies for Managing Demand

To effectively manage demand during peak periods, businesses should consider several strategies:

  • Inventory Management: Maintain optimal stock levels by forecasting demand accurately.
  • Supplier Coordination: Work closely with suppliers to ensure timely delivery of N2O.
  • Flexible Production: Adjust production schedules to align with demand fluctuations.

These strategies not only help in meeting customer demands but also in reducing costs associated with overproduction or last-minute procurement.

Technological Advancements

Technological advancements play a significant role in managing N2O supply chains. Automated systems and IoT devices can provide real-time monitoring of inventory levels, ensuring that businesses are alerted to potential shortages or excesses. This proactive approach allows for swift adjustments to production and supply plans.

Moreover, cloud-based platforms facilitate seamless communication between different departments and suppliers, streamlining the entire process from production to delivery.

Environmental Considerations

As N2O is a greenhouse gas, its usage and emissions have environmental implications. Companies are increasingly adopting sustainable practices to minimize their carbon footprint. Practices such as recycling N2O and implementing efficient manufacturing processes not only help the environment but also enhance brand reputation.

By investing in green technologies, businesses can align their operations with global sustainability goals, appealing to environmentally conscious consumers and stakeholders.
